The prosecution thought it was plausible, but Goldsmith and the judge and later, the Washington State Supreme Court agreed that there was no evidence that Fair and the neighbor had been accomplices. Fairs second trial took place two years later, from May 7 to June 11, 2019, and was a condensed version of the first. Second, Fairs attorneys pointed out that, despite the killers attempts to destroy all biological evidence, detectives obtained numerous traces of DNA from the scene, some of which potentially implicated Fair, others of which potentially implicated other people. But the DNA traces were mixed, meaning they were difficult to read, and it was difficult to determine when and how the traces were deposited.
